Abstract

Abstract. This data paper introduces Caravan-CMIP6, a dataset of climate change projections for large-sample hydrologic studies. Caravan-CMIP6 includes projections from an ensemble of 12 climate models from the sixth Coupled Model Intercomparison Project (CMIP6), for the historical experiment (1850–2014) and three Shared Socio-economic Pathways (SSPs). The dataset includes projections for all catchments within ten large-sample hydrometeorological datasets: Caravan, CAMELS, CAMELS-AUS-v2, CAMELS-BR, CAMELS-CH CAMELS-CL, CAMELS-COL, CAMELS-DE, CAMELS-GB-v2, CAMELS-IND. For each large-sample hydrometeorological dataset, I provide CMIP6 projections for all meteorological variables that can be readily extracted from climate models, including precipitation, temperature, evapotranspiration, humidity, radiation, pressure, and wind speed. I bias-correct the climate model output to match the observed climatology within each dataset. This dataset can facilitate the use of large-sample hydrologic datasets and models for climate change projection. All raw and bias-corrected data are available at https://doi.org/10.20383/103.01644.
